Identifying the origin of the oil leaking on your Bmw Serie 5

If you see fluid leaking from under your Bmw Serie 5, the first action to take is to verify all of your levels (power steering, engine oil, brake fluid, coolant) to find out if any of them can promptly be defined as the source of the leak. To limit the risks, it is certainly vital to verify your levels every 2 weeks to avoid any risk of engine breakage.
In our circumstance we will only be interested in circumstance you detect oil leaking from your Bmw Serie 5, as far as engine oil is concerned, the liquid will be quite viscous and in shades of brown to black and if it is gearbox oil, it will be rather in amber tones and will have a strong annoying smell.
It’s not always easy to find the origin of the oil that leaks on a Bmw Serie 5 because of the accessibility of the engine block, even so here are the simple steps to follow to find the source of the oil:

  • Uncover the point where the oil falls, the region from which it spills onto the floor…
  • Track down the route of the dripping oil to its basis, if the blot is too big, don’t be reluctant to clean the engine block and drive to have the ability to discover it more easily.
  • That will help, here is a list of the auto parts that mostly trigger oil to leak from a car: the drain plug and its seal; one of your crankcase gaskets; the oil pressure switch; the oil filter; the transmission drain plug; the transmission sealing rings.

If it is possible, repair the part that made the oil to leak on your Bmw Serie 5.

Now that you’ve identified the origin of the oil leaking, it’s time to get down to business. Obviously, for a while, you’ll be able to add more oil to top up the level, based on its severity, but remember that this is not a durable remedy and that the leak could become worse at any time. We are going to present you the repairs that we think you can undertake alone with some knowledge, tools and depending to the accessibility that you are going to have on your engine. Whatever the case, you should know that after repairing an oil leak on a Bmw Serie 5, you will have to change your engine or gearbox oil.

Oil leakage from the drain plug and its seal on Bmw Serie 5

In this circumstance, the solution is quite easy, you just have to lift your Bmw Serie 5, whenever possible totally horizontal, remove your drain plug, drain your engine oil, change your drain gasket, tighten the plug to the right torque and verify the hot engine to make sure the leak has been repaired.

Oil leaking over from the oil filter of my Bmw Serie 5

In the event that your oil leak comes from your oil filter, you will basically need to change it. To get this done, take a filter wrench, remove the old filter, ensuring that that the gasket does not stick to the engine, set the new filter and tighten it moderately. Same check, hot check if oil is leaking from your Bmw Serie 5.

Oil leaking from the pressure switch of my Bmw Serie 5

To conclude, if it is your pressure switch that is the reason of your leak on your Bmw Serie 5, you can, according to its accessibility, reach it and change it quickly. To achieve this, set a drain tray under the part, disconnect the electrical wire, remove the part, quickly reposition the replacement pressure switch, clean the assembly and do a hot test to make sure that you no longer have any oil leaking from your Bmw Serie 5.

For any other type of leak, we recommend you to go to your mechanic because the repair will involve too much expertise and tools to be done serenely alone.
